MCHP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

635 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Microchip Technology (MCHP)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$13.5B — up 21% from $11.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 77 funds opened new MCHP positions and 50 closed out — a net gain of 27 holders — while 200 added to existing stakes and 269 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$198M. The largest seller was Massachusetts Financial Services, cutting an estimated $125M.
